Average rent in Emerald, QLD2026

Emerald is part of the Central Highlands (Qld) council area and sits 656km out from the Brisbane CBD, with around 14,089 residents at the 2021 ABS Census. Renters here typically pay $300/week, which is below the Queensland median of $359/week. About 45% of households rent — the rest are owners or paying down a mortgage.

Renting in Emerald

Emerald sits below the Queensland median, with the typical renter paying $300/week — 16% less than the state-wide $359/week baseline (ABS Census 2021). The suburb skews owner-occupied: 52% own outright or with a mortgage, and only 45% rent. Housing stock is dominated by separate houses (80%), with limited high-density development. Population sits at 14,089, the median age is 32, and the most common occupation is Technicians and Trades Workers. 15% of residents were born overseas. Emerald is 656km from Brisbane, often putting it outside the inner-ring rent pressure zone — though state-level rent indices show the 2021 baseline is now meaningfully out of date.
